Herbert Poetzl wrote:
> On Thu, Sep 07, 2006 at 03:22:30PM +0200, Cedric Le Goater wrote:
> 
>>all,
>>
>>'pspace' sounds wrong when you know about the other namespaces :
>>
>>struct nsproxy {
>>	atomic_t count;
>>	spinlock_t nslock;
>>	struct uts_namespace *uts_ns;
>>	struct ipc_namespace *ipc_ns;
>>	struct user_namespace *user_ns;
>>	struct namespace *namespace;
>>};
>>
>>'proc_namespace' might be confusing, what about 'task_namespace' ?
>>
>>'namespace' should probably be renamed to something like 'mnt_namespace' ?
> 
> 
> what about vfs_namespace?
imho later we will need introduce fs namespace etc.
at least I see additional fs_namespace which allows to control which filesystems are visible
in the context. And such fs_namespace should be separate from mnt_namespace.

Kirill
